What “high quality paint” really means
A great paint job isn’t just the color. It’s:
- Smooth patchwork that disappears
- Clean cut-in lines on trim and edges
- Consistent sheen (no flashing spots)
- Proper surface prep so paint bonds correctly
- Durable finish choices for kitchens, baths, and hallways

FAQ
How long does an interior paint job take?
Many rooms can be completed in 1–3 days, depending on prep and number of coats.
Do you fix drywall before painting?
Yes—patching and smoothing is often the key to a premium finish.
What paint finish is best for high-traffic areas?
Durable finishes (often eggshell/satin depending on space) hold up better and clean easier.
